Leaving a Love Legacy workshop Feb. 28 at public library
Beyond Budgeting of Bluffton will host an informal workshop, "Leaving a Love Legacy," from 6:15 to 7:45 p.m., Monday, Feb. 28, in the Richland Room of the Bluffton Public Library, according to Beth Boehr of Beyond Budgeting.
During the interactive workshop Boehr will share with participants what documents are needed and practical organizational tips so that important documents may be easily located in case of an emergency.
"Injuries and accidents, hospitalization, serious illness, life-changing emergencies...are you prepared to handle life's unexpected obstacles? Boehr said. "Life teaches us to expect the unexpected. By the end of the seminar participants should have a greater understanding of how to prepare for the future and gain peace of mind for themselves and their families."
For more information or to registers for the workshop call 419-358-4146. The workshop is free but a binder containing all information and forms will be available for purchase for $20.
